Buyatab, a subsidiary of Stored Value Solutions and Corpay, Inc., is not just about team lunches, fun company events or puppies in the office (although we have all 3!). A FinTech maverick and officially one of the most popular technology companies in BC, Buyatab is a leading supplier of advanced online gift card infrastructure, technology and marketing services for leading brands. Working with some of the world’s leading brands (including Four Seasons, Fairmont, Whole Foods Market, Lowes), we are recognized for our solution and design flexibility, focus on client brand standards, high-quality customer support, and fraud protection guarantee. As a result, our clients are positioned to grow their gift card business, enhance their brands, gain a competitive edge, and leverage the rapid growth in mobile device use and social media.

Role Responsibilities
The responsibilities of the role will include:
- Working with Product, Client Success and Customer Service teams to research, understand, and validate user needs and market opportunities; and translate them into product requirements.
- Forming a deep understanding of our users and new markets by conducting user research, synthesizing data from metrics and sales/customer conversations, and testing core assumptions.
- Assisting the Product Manager on defining product strategy by closely working with all stakeholders to achieve company’s strategic goals.
- Working with highly efficient engineering teams to deliver products built with cutting edge technology effectively and usefully.
- Managing project scope by making tradeoffs between key software requirements such as time vs cost, software security vs speed.
- Creating and groom the product backlog based on priority driven from users and Product Strategy.
- Managing both internal stakeholder and user expectations of application features and capabilities based on team capacity and initiative estimates.
- Working with engineering teams to assess and mitigate potential security vulnerabilities in the product.
